ATHENS, Ga. – Virginia men’s tennis senior Thai-Son Kwiatkowski (Charlotte, N.C.) and junior Collin Altamirano (Sacramento, Calif.) are competing at the 2017 NCAA Men’s Tennis Singles Championship, being held May 24-29 at the Dan Magill Tennis Complex in Athens, Ga.
Kwiatkowski began play with a first-round match on Wednesday (May 24) against Julian Cash of Oklahoma State, advancing with a 6-4, 6-4 win. Kwiatkowski will face Daniel Valent of Vanderbilt on Thursday at 11:30 a.m. in the Round of 32.
Altamirano fell 6-4, 3-6, 6-3 to David Biosca of East Tennessee State on Wednesday in the first round and was eliminated from the tournament.
Kwiatkowski and Altamirano were at-large selections selected to the 64-player singles field. All singles players must have a minimum of 13 completed singles matches, with six matches in the spring, in order to be selected as an automatic qualifier or an at-large selection.
This is the third time Kwiatkowski will be competing in the NCAA Singles Championship while Altamirano will be competing for the second time.
